## Data Stores — Murkwatch FD Hunt

If you're writing a plugin for Murkwatch, heads up: we're chasing leaked file descriptors, and most leaks trace back to plugins opening their own DB handles and never closing them. Please use the shared pool instead of rolling your own. The pool fronts the Bramleydale metrics database, which also holds the FD audit tables. The pool reads its target from the string below.

replica DSN, kajep-yahag: mssql://praok_svc:iF@db-8d68.plorvaio.local:5432/eliion

This PR addresses the garbage-collection pauses in the Corvane matching service that caused timeout spikes support has been fielding since last month. Root cause: the old heap sizing let the tenured region grow until full collections stalled match dispatch for seconds. We switched to a pause-target collector and capped allocation bursts. Customer-visible symptom should disappear; no API changes. The new tuning constants are listed below.

constants for tageg-kagag:
QUOTAS = {
    "kelax": 495,
    "istath": 366,
    "tammir": 108,
    "novdor": 730,
    "casax": 816,
    "quenael": 874,
    "pelius": 403,
}

Ticket: Nightly backfill scheduler failing to connect

The Larkspool backfill scheduler has failed its connection handshake three nights running, so the 02:00 window produced no data for the Quartzline reports. Retries exhaust after five attempts and the job marks itself stalled. We verified the staging credentials rotate correctly; the issue appears isolated to the primary replica endpoint. For the next release cut, point the scheduler at the connection string below.

primary connection of tajeg-tajop = postgresql://julax_svc:DI@db-e7f3.kelvidyn.corp:5432/rusdor

Quarterly Planning Note — Divestiture of the Coastal Tooling Unit

For the finance team: the sale of the Coastal Tooling unit to Pellmark Industries remains on track for close in Q3. Please finalize the carve-out balance sheet, reconcile intercompany positions, and prepare the working-capital adjustment schedule by month-end. Audit support requests should be prioritized. For planning purposes, note the following sensitive item:

internal memo for hawef-kahif: The finance team signed off on a budget of $25.9 million for Project Sorox. The renewal with Pelokek Logistics closes at $51.7 million a year, 52 percent below the last contract.